Bellaire Little League hosted a ribbon cutting ceremony for the new Tiras Family Complex at Mulberry Park. The fun day also included a crawfish boil fundraiser, moms softball event and games for the kids. The festivities began at 2 p.m. and many Little Leaguers and their families hung out together as late as 11 p.m.

The Tiras family has been part of Bellaire Little League since 2002; Scott Tiras has coached every year since (with wife Jennifer as team mom).
